
var valor = 10;
var aumenta = 3;

var maxTam = 13;
var minTam = 7;
    
function font(_div, z){
  try{
    var campo = document.getElementById(_div);
    
    if(z == '+'){    
      for( var x = 0; x < campo.childNodes.length; x++ ){
        var tag = campo.childNodes[x].nodeName.toLowerCase();
        
        //alert(tag);
        
        if( tag == 'p' || tag == 'h2' || tag == 'h3' || tag == 'ul' || tag == 'fieldset'){          
          if(tag == 'ul'){
            for(var y = 0; y < campo.childNodes[x].childNodes.length; y++){
              
              //alert("Valor X: " + x + ", TAG do x: " + campo.childNodes[x].nodeName + "\nValor Y: " + y + ", TAG do y: " + campo.childNodes[x].childNodes[y].nodeName + "\nValor do y: " + campo.childNodes[x].childNodes[y].innerHTML);
              
              if(campo.childNodes[x].childNodes[y].nodeName != "#text"){
                if(valor >= maxTam){
                  aumenta = 0;
                }else{
                  aumenta = 3;
                }
                
                valor = valor + aumenta;
                v1 = valor;
                campo.childNodes[x].childNodes[y].style.fontSize = valor + 'pt';
                valor = valor - aumenta;
              }
            }
          }
          
          if(tag != "#text"){
            if(valor >= maxTam){
              aumenta = 0;
            }else{
              aumenta = 3;
            }
            valor = valor + aumenta;
            v1 = valor;
            campo.childNodes[x].style.fontSize = valor + 'pt';
            valor = valor - aumenta;
          }
        }
      }
      valor = v1;
    }else{
      for( var x = 0; x < campo.childNodes.length; x++ ){
        var tag = campo.childNodes[x].nodeName.toLowerCase();
        //alert("TAG: " + tag);
        if( tag == 'p' || tag == 'h2' || tag == 'h3' || tag == 'ul' || tag == 'fieldset'){
          if(tag == 'ul'){
            for(var y = 0; y < campo.childNodes[x].childNodes.length; y++){
              if(campo.childNodes[x].childNodes[y].nodeName != "#text"){
                if(valor <= minTam){
                  aumenta = 0;
                }else{
                  aumenta = 3;
                }
                valor = valor - aumenta;
                v1 = valor;
                campo.childNodes[x].childNodes[y].style.fontSize = valor + 'pt';
                valor = valor + aumenta;
              }
            }
          }
          
          if(tag != "#text"){
            if(valor <= minTam){
              aumenta = 0;
            }else{
              aumenta = 3;
            }
        		valor = valor - aumenta;
            v1 = valor;
            campo.childNodes[x].style.fontSize = valor + 'pt';
            valor = valor + aumenta;
          }
        }
      }
      valor = v1;
    }
  }catch(err){
    alert("Erro: " + err.description);
  }
}


function enviaForm(){
  try{
    var ajax_Carregando = "<b>Enviando...</b>";
    
    var nome = $F('nome');
  	var email = $F('mail');
  	var assunto = $F('assunto');
  	var msg = $F('msg');
  	var url = 'EnviaMail.asp';
  	var pars = 'vNome=' + nome + '&' + 'vMail=' + email + '&' + 'vAssunto=' + assunto + '&' + 'vMsg=' + msg;
  		
    var myAjax = new Ajax.Request( url, { method: 'post', parameters: pars, onComplete: mostraResposta });
    
    $('form').innerHTML = ajax_Carregando;
  }catch(err){
    document.write("Erro: " + err.description);
  }
} 

function mostraResposta(resposta)	{
	$('form').innerHTML = resposta.responseText;
}


function mostraDiv(){
  for(var i=0; i<arguments.length; i++){ 
    document.getElementById(arguments[i]).style.display = 'block';
  }
}


function btMenu1(id,caminho)
{
	document.getElementById(id).src = caminho;
}

function btMenu1_OUT(id,caminho)
{
	document.getElementById(id).src = caminho;
}

function abrirIMG(caminho,largura,altura) {
	window.open(caminho,"IMAGENS","width="+ largura +", height="+ altura +", top=50, left=100 ");
}

